Central Railway has registered impressive freight loading figures for April 2026, moving 6.72 million tonnes (MT) of cargo in 2,582 rakes and generating revenue of Rs 708.14 crore.

The railway loaded 6.72 MT in April 2026 as compared to 6.57 MT in April 2025, registering a growth of over 2 per cent in tonnage. The number of rakes also increased from 2,490 to 2,582, marking an addition of 92 rakes.
